2. Choose the Right Social Media Platforms
Not every platform is suitable for every business. Each has its own culture, audience, and strengths. Here’s a quick breakdown:
- Facebook: Great for local businesses, eCommerce, and community building.
- Instagram: Visual storytelling for lifestyle brands, fashion, food, and fitness.
- LinkedIn: Professional networking, B2B services, and personal branding.
- TikTok: Viral short-form video content for younger audiences.
- Pinterest: Ideal for niches like fashion, DIY, food, and home decor.
- X (formerly Twitter): News, trending topics, and real-time customer service.
Focus on 1-3 platforms where your audience is most active instead of trying to be everywhere at once.

9. Collaborate With Influencers
Influencer marketing is a smart shortcut to reaching a broader audience. Depending on your niche and budget, you can collaborate with:
- Micro-influencers (1K–100K followers) for niche-specific engagement.
- Macro-influencers (100K–1M followers) for mainstream exposure.
- Mega-influencers (1M+ followers) for large-scale brand visibility.
Make sure the influencer’s audience aligns with your brand and message.
10. Analyze and Optimize
Successful social media marketing requires ongoing analysis. Monitor key metrics like:
- Engagement rate (likes, shares, comments)
- Click-through rate (CTR)
- Follower growth
- Conversion rates
- Website traffic from social platforms
Use tools like Google Analytics, Meta Business Suite, or Sprout Social to identify what works — and improve what doesn’t.
11. Leverage Paid Advertising
While organic reach is valuable, social media marketing gets a significant boost from paid ads.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n offer precise targeting based on:
- Location
- Demographics
- Interests
- Behaviors
Start with a small budget, A/B test different ad creatives, and scale up campaigns that show strong ROI.
